Output 6ec60f596f52f964ba74673c3871a825650363c4fe656ade2d557b5491a1be7e:1

value
40900860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bcdef9026ec8df0d62b354eb4897ad4e876b9f OP_EQUAL
address
MEodAoZwo7zkwWvdZRVMXsRDURJVoyt6Jq
transaction
6ec60f596f52f964ba74673c3871a825650363c4fe656ade2d557b5491a1be7e
spent
true